Top 5 Air Travel Apps on Android in Bolivia - Q2 2022
In Q2 2022, the top air travel apps in Bolivia on Android saw varied performance in weekly downloads and revenue. Detailed insights from Sensor Tower reveal the trends.
During the second quarter of 2022, the top air travel apps on the Android platform in Bolivia demonstrated a range of performance metrics, including weekly downloads and revenue. Here's a closer look at how these apps fared:
Flightradar24 Flight Tracker exper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, peaking at $30 in mid-April and ending the quarter with $27 in the final week of June. Weekly downloads saw a high of 191 in mid-April, gradually declining to 118 by the end of June.
AMASZONAS LÍNEA AÉREA saw a peak in weekly downloads in mid-April with 156 downloads but faced a decline towards the end of the quarter, closing June with 105 downloads.
avianca maintained relatively stable weekly downloads throughout the quarter, with numbers ranging from a high of 126 in early April to a low of 56 by the end of June.
LATAM Airlines had weekly downloads fluctuating between 120 in early April and 67 in mid-June, ending the quarter on a higher note with 100 downloads in the last week of June.
Vuelos Bolivia saw its weekly downloads peak at 131 in mid-April, followed by a dip to 67 in early May, and then a recovery to 101 by the end of June.
